Sustainable Furniture: What to Consider
Evaluating sustainable furniture involves a thorough examination of the materials utilized in manufacturing. Selecting materials like reclaimed wood and bamboo furniture stands out due to their minimal environmental impact.
Certifications such as FSC signal responsible sourcing, adding credibility to choices made. The benefits of these selections extend beyond aesthetics, as they can significantly enhance indoor air quality by reducing low VOC emissions, thereby promoting a healthier atmosphere for employees.
Key Features to Look For
- Natural Finishes: Aim for options that utilize organic materials and nontoxic coatings, which support better indoor air quality.
- Ergonomic Design: Focus on furniture that not only looks good but supports workplace wellness through proper posture.
- Modular Systems: These allow for adaptability, promoting waste reduction as needs change.
- Sustainable Textiles: Select upholstery made from renewable resources that align with ecoinnovation efforts.

Natural Finishes: What Are Your Options?
Choosing natural finishes for your sustainable office furniture can enhance both aesthetic appeal and functionality. These eco-conscious options encompass a variety of finishes, such as oil, wax, varnish, and lacquer, each presenting distinct advantages:
- Oil finishes: Known for their ease of application and repairability, making them a popular choice for busy workplaces.
- Wax finishes: Derived from natural origins, requiring minimal maintenance and enhancing the longevity of surfaces.
- Varnish finishes: Offer excellent durability and protection against wear and tear.
- Lacquer finishes: Provide a sleek aesthetic appeal with quick-drying capabilities.
Utilizing these natural finishes not only creates an inviting atmosphere but also contributes to an eco-conscious workspace by minimizing harmful chemical use and supporting sustainability.
Nontoxic Coatings: Ensuring Indoor Air Quality
Prioritizing nontoxic coatings is crucial for maintaining indoor air quality in commercial spaces. Selecting safe, green alternatives plays a significant role in ensuring workplace health. For instance, GREENGUARD certification and similar standards guarantee that these products are free from harmful substances, particularly volatile organic compounds (VOCs).
Evaluating chemical compositions is essential to avoid common air pollutants, leading to a rise in the popularity of nontoxic options among businesses committed to corporate sustainability.

Volume Discounts in Wholesale: What You Need to Know
Volume discounts play a significant role in shaping effective purchasing strategies. These discounts refer to price reductions offered by suppliers when customers buy larger quantities, benefitting both parties involved.
Engaging in bulk purchasing not only maximizes savings but also fosters customer loyalty and strengthens supplier relationships.
Benefits of Volume Discounts
Implementing volume discounts encourages larger orders, creating economies of scale that provide a competitive edge in the market.
Sustainable furniture, for instance, can be obtained at reduced costs when purchased in bulk, allowing businesses to save while promoting eco-friendly options.
Discounts typically vary based on quantity thresholds, with common reductions of 10% or 20% applied after reaching specific units.
